| Obverse description | Within an open laurel wreath, a royal crown in relief above a recumbent sphinx facing left. The legend 'BRITISH FORCES IN EGYPT' appears in two lines across the upper field. |

| Reverse description | The upper field bears the engraved legend 'COMMAND TEAM FOOTBALL CHAMPIONSHIP WINNERS' in five lines. An open laurel wreath occupies the lower portion of the field, with hallmark cartouches visible on the wreath ties, and a blank central area intended for recipient engraving. |
